Janine Pesci

Talent Development Director at Okland Construction Company, Inc.

Janine Pesci has over 20 years of experience in talent development and human resources. Their most recent position is with Okland Construction, where they serve as the Talent Development Director. In this role, they manage a team responsible for executing a global talent strategy, overseeing diversity, equity, and inclusion efforts, and implementing a talent framework for hiring and onboarding.

Prior to Okland Construction, Janine worked at Gensler for 15 years, holding various leadership roles. As the Chief People Officer, they led organizational transformation and developed human capital strategies for a globally dispersed workforce. Janine set the global strategy for professional and leadership development programs, engagement strategies, and training initiatives. Janine also founded and grew the Global Talent Development studio at Gensler, partnering with executive leadership to deliver talent programs to team members across multiple countries.

Before their time at Gensler, Janine worked at the Urban Land Institute as the Vice President of Education. In this role, they managed a large programming budget and oversaw the design, marketing, and management of educational programs, conferences, workshops, and real estate school.

Overall, Janine Pesci has a strong background in talent development, human resources, and organizational transformation, with a focus on driving business objectives and creating a positive employee experience.

Janine Pesci ear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Sociology and Gerontology from Brigham Young University, which they attended from 1978 to 1982.
